.hero-img {
    filter: brightness(0.8) blur(1px);
}

h1 {
    margin-bottom: 4rem;
    color: #F6F6F6;
}

h2 {
    text-align: center;
    margin: 1em 0;
    padding: 0 1rem;
}

.main_priceboard p {
    margin: 1em 0;
}

.strong {
    font-weight: 600;
}

.button-container {
    display: flex;
    justify-content: center;
    margin: 2rem 0;
}

.button {
    background-color: hsl(189, 75%, 39%);
    color: white;
    border: 1px solid hsl(189, 75%, 39%);
    padding: 0.75rem 2rem;
    border-radius: 50vh;
    font-size: 1.25rem;
    transition:
        background-color 0.3s ease-in-out,
        color 0.3s ease-in-out,
        border 0.3s ease-in-out;
}

.button:is(:hover, :focus-visible) {
    background-color: white;
    color: hsl(189, 75%, 39%);
    border: 1px solid hsl(189, 75%, 39%);
}

.priceboard-img {
    border-radius: 15px;
}

.priceboard_information {
    padding-block: 1rem;
}

.priceboard_information-content {
    display: flex;
    justify-content: center;
    align-items: center;
    gap: 4rem;
    padding: 1rem;
    max-width: 1200px;
    margin: 0 auto;

    @media (max-width: 768px) {
        flex-direction: column;
        gap: 2rem;
    }
}

.priceboard_information-text {
    flex: 1;
}

.priceboard_information-title {
    text-align: unset;
    padding: 0;
}

.priceboard_information-img img {
    max-height: 40rem;
}

.priceboard_slider-clients,
.priceboard_call-to-action {
    background-color: hsl(0, 0%, 96%);
}

.priceboard_slider-clients_content {
    max-width: 90%;
    margin: 1rem auto;
}

.priceboard_installations-title {
    margin-block: 2rem;
}

.priceboard_installations-content {
    max-width: 1200px;
    margin: 0 auto;
    padding-inline: 1rem;

    @media (min-width: 550px) {
        padding-inline: 4rem;
    }
}

.priceboard_installations_slider {
    margin-block: 4rem;
}

.priceboard_installations_slider .slick-list {
    overflow-x: clip;
    overflow-y: unset;
}

.priceboard_installations_img {
    opacity: 0.15;
    border-radius: 10px;
    max-width: 20rem;
    transition:
        opacity 0.5s ease-in-out,
        transform 0.5s ease-in-out;
}

.slick-center .priceboard_installations_img {
    transform: scale(1.2);
    opacity: 1;
    position: relative;
    z-index: 1;
}

.priceboard_installations_slider .priceboard_installations_item {
    display: flex;
    justify-content: center;
    align-items: center;
    padding: 1.25rem;
    cursor: grab;
}
.priceboard_installations_slider .priceboard_installations_item:active {
    cursor: grabbing;
}

.priceboard_slick-prev,
.priceboard_slick-next {
    position: absolute;
    top: 50%;
    transform: translateY(-50%);
    background-color: transparent;
    border: none;
    cursor: pointer;
}

.priceboard_slick-prev {
    left: -4rem;
}

.priceboard_slick-next {
    right: -4rem;
}

.priceboard_slick-next img {
    rotate: 180deg;
}

.priceboard_call-to-action {
    position: relative;
    isolation: isolate;
    background-image: url("../imgs/solutions/priceboard-decoration.png");
    background-repeat: no-repeat;
    background-size: contain;
    background-position: 10%;

    @media (max-width: 1200px) {
        background-position: left;
    }

    @media (max-width: 1000px) {
        background-image: none;
    }
}

.priceboard_call-to-action::before {
    content: url("../imgs/solutions/Vector2.svg");
    position: absolute;
    bottom: 0;
    left: 0;
    z-index: -1;
}

.priceboard_call-to-action::after {
    content: url("../imgs/solutions/Vector3.svg");
    position: absolute;
    top: 0;
    right: 0;
    z-index: -1;
}

.priceboard_call-to-action-title {
    max-width: 40rem;
    margin: 4rem auto;
}

p.priceboard_call-to-action-text {
    max-width: 40rem;
    margin-inline: auto;
    padding-inline: 1rem;
    text-align: center;
}

.priceboard_call-to-action-button {
    margin-block: 4rem;
}
